Abstract

The utility model discloses an auxiliary roller mounting and adjusting mechanism of a steel plate forming machine, which comprises a supporting seat, wherein the top of the supporting seat is rotatably connected with a rotating frame, an auxiliary roller shaft is arranged on the rotating frame, an auxiliary roller wheel is arranged on the auxiliary roller shaft, a vertically arranged screw rod is arranged in the supporting seat, a hand-operated wheel is arranged on one side of the supporting seat, a bevel gear transmission assembly is arranged between a rotating shaft of the hand-operated wheel and the screw rod, a lifting block is arranged on the screw rod in a threaded connection manner, and two ejector rods hinged with the rotating frame are hinged to two sides of the lifting block. Detailed Description
The following detailed description of the present invention is provided in conjunction with the accompanying drawings, but it should be understood that the scope of the present invention is not limited to the specific embodiments.
The specific embodiments of the present invention are such that: as shown in fig. 1-4, an auxiliary roller installation adjusting mechanism of a steel plate forming machine comprises a supporting seat 1, the top of the supporting seat 1 is rotatably connected with a rotating frame 2, an auxiliary roller shaft 3 is arranged on the rotating frame 2, an auxiliary roller wheel 4 is arranged on the auxiliary roller shaft 3, a vertically arranged screw rod 5 is arranged in the supporting seat 1, one side of the supporting seat 1 is provided with a hand-operated wheel 6, a bevel gear transmission assembly 7 is arranged between a rotating shaft of the hand-operated wheel 6 and the screw rod 5, a lifting block 8 is arranged on the screw rod 5 in a threaded connection manner, two ejector rods 9 hinged to the rotating frame 2 are hinged to two sides of the lifting block 8, two slidable rotating pins can be arranged on the rotating frame 2, and the rotatable sleeve at the top end of the ejector rod 9 is arranged on the rotating pins. In this steel sheet forming machine's supplementary roller installation adjustment mechanism, rotate hand round 6 and can drive screw rod 5 through bevel gear drive assembly 7 and rotate, screw rod 5 rotates and can drive elevator 8 and go up and down, and elevator 8 goes up and down to drive the rotating turret 2 through ejector pin 9 and rotates to realize adjusting supplementary roller 3 and supplementary running roller 4 on the rotating turret 2, angle modulation is convenient, accurate.
In this embodiment, two supporting vertical plates 10 are disposed on the supporting base 1 in parallel and opposite to each other, and a hinge shaft 11 for supporting the rotating frame 2 is disposed on the two supporting vertical plates 10.
In this embodiment, two horizontal plates 12 arranged in parallel up and down are disposed between the two vertical supporting plates 10, the two horizontal plates 12 are provided with bearing seats for supporting the screw 5, and the hand-operated wheel 6 is disposed on the outer side of one of the vertical supporting plates 10.
In this embodiment, the transverse plate 12 located above is provided with a sliding groove 13 adapted to the top bar 9, so as to guide the rotation of the top bar 9 and prevent the lifting block 8 from rotating.
In this embodiment, guide rods 16 slidably connected to the lift blocks 8 are provided at both ends of the horizontal plate 12 to guide the lifting of the lift blocks 8 and prevent the lift blocks 8 from rotating.
In this embodiment, the supporting vertical plate 10 is provided with an arc-shaped groove 14, scale marks are provided on two sides of the arc-shaped groove 14 on the supporting vertical plate 10, and a sliding pin 15 adapted to the arc-shaped groove 14 is provided on a lateral portion of the rotating frame 2.
Through the directional scale mark position of sliding pin 15, can judge the pivoted angle of rotating turret 2, realize quick, accurate adjusting auxiliary roller shaft 3's position.
In this embodiment, the center of the arc-shaped slot 14 coincides with the axis of the hinge shaft 11, so as to prevent the sliding pin 15 from being locked when the rotating frame 2 rotates.
